WHAT IS KIRTAN?

Kirtan meditation is the hearing and chanting of mantras (sacred spiritual sounds) in a call-and-response style. Weaving together melody, music and mantra, kirtan is an interactive experience which is both meditative and joyful. This beautiful group meditation engages the senses and uplifts the spirit. Kirtan can be mellow and slow or upbeat and energetic with dancing, and anywhere in-between. Anyone can experience kirtan, regardless of age, background, religion, etc.
